Systemvariablen auslesen: $HOSTNAME

  • Ab sofort steht euch hier im Forum die neue Add-on Verwaltung zur Verfügung – eine zentrale Plattform für alles rund um Erweiterungen und Add-ons für den DSM.

    Damit haben wir einen Ort, an dem Lösungen von Nutzern mit der Community geteilt werden können. Über die Team Funktion können Projekte auch gemeinsam gepflegt werden.

    Was die Add-on Verwaltung kann und wie es funktioniert findet Ihr hier

    Hier geht es zu den Add-ons

Status
Für weitere Antworten geschlossen.

r000633

Benutzer
Registriert
29. Aug. 2013
Beiträge
52
Reaktionspunkte
0
Punkte
6
Ich versuche in einer Box per Script den Systemnamen als Parameter für eine Logdatei zu nutzen um später mal nachvollziehen zu können, welcher Server welches script schon ausgeführt hat.

Ich kann zwar mit dem Befehl
hostname
den Namen auf Kommandozeile ausgeben lassen,
die "übliche" systemvariable
$HOSTNAME
ist aber leer.

Dies ist sowohl auf einer alten DS107 als auch auf einer neueren DS112 der Fall.


Kann mir jemand einen Tip geben , wie das zu regeln ist ?
 
Hallo,
setze in das Script
Rich (BBCode):
HOSTNAME=`hostname`
Rich (BBCode):
DS411plusII> HOSTNAME=`hostname`
DS411plusII> echo $HOSTNAME
DS411plusII

Gruß Götz
 
Gelöst...

Danke dir Götz,
das war genau was ich brauchte.
 
Status
Für weitere Antworten geschlossen.
 

Kaffeautomat

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.

Als Dankeschön schalten wir deinen Account werbefrei.

:coffee:

Hier gehts zum Kaffeeautomat